Output 84acbafa6164c7444116cbfa60c571783fe07124ca5c1b8c734800fc4fe7bc76:1

value
609420
script pubkey
OP_0 OP_PUSHBYTES_20 8e15a1465cbb303e51ae1f528fade5248aebd48f
address
ltc1q3c26z3juhvcru5dwrafglt09yj9wh4y0duwnrw
transaction
84acbafa6164c7444116cbfa60c571783fe07124ca5c1b8c734800fc4fe7bc76
spent
true